Summary
Serves and executes warrants and other processes issued for the Municipal Court. Requires:
  • Certified Peace Officer Certification

Essential Functions
  • Serve and execute warrants;
  • Arrest persons; explain their legal rights and take them into custody;
  • Refer to local directories and contact various public agencies, utility companies, and merchants in attempting to locate subjects;
  • Maintain records and files;
  • Return prisoners from out-of-town to enter pleas in court;
  • Transport arrestees from other agencies;
  • Perform related duties as directed.

Qualifications
Completion of a high school diploma or the equivalent with an additional six months of responsible work involving public contact; or any combination of relevant education and experience which provides the following:
Knowledge and Abilities
Knowledge of:
  • Learn the elementary principles of the laws of arrest and custody;
  • Learn Municipal Court procedures;
  • Understand oral and written instructions;
  • Deal tactfully and firmly with the public;
  • Communicate effectively with the others.

Physical Requirements:
  • Frequently lift and carry up to 10 pounds, and occasionally lift and carry up to 25 pounds.
  • Occasionally stand and walk during the shift.
  • Coordinate eye, hand, and foot movement in order to operate a vehicle.

Part-time employees who have at least six (6) months continuous employment may be paid for all holidays except the Veterans Day floating holiday. Part-time employees are not eligible for the Veteran's Day floating holiday because City offices are not closed on that day. The number of hours granted these employees as holiday pay is based on the average number of hours normally worked in a day.
The City designates the eleven (11) following dates as holidays to be observed with pay:
New Year's Day - January 1
Martin Luther King Day - Third Monday in January
Good Friday - Friday before Easter
Memorial Day - Last Monday in May
Independence Day - July 4
Labor Day - First Monday of September
Veterans Day - November 11 (Floating Holiday)
Thanksgiving Day - Fourth Thursday in November
Friday after Thanksgiving (Fourth Friday in November)
Christmas Eve - December 24
Christmas Day - December 25
